90 research outputs found

    Towards reliable geographic broadcasting in vehicular networks

    Get PDF
    In Vehicular ad hoc Networks (VANETs), safety-related messages are broadcasted amongst cars, helping to improve drivers' awareness of the road situation. VANETs’ reliability are highly affected by channel contention. This thesis first addresses the issue of channel use efficiency in geographical broadcasts (geocasts). Constant connectivity changes inside a VANET make the existing routing algorithms unsuitable. This thesis presents a geocast algorithm that uses a metric to estimate the ratio of useful to useless packet received. Simulations showed that this algorithm is more channel-efficient than the farthest-first strategy. It also exposes a parameter, allowing it to adapt to channel load. Second, this thesis presents a method of estimating channel load for providing feedback to moderate the offered load. A theoretical model showing the relationship between channel load and the idle time between transmissions is presented and used to estimate channel contention. Unsaturated stations on the network were shown to have small but observable effects on this relationship. In simulations, channel estimators based on this model show higher accuracy and faster convergence time than by observing packet collisions. These estimators are also less affected by unsaturated stations than by observing packet collisions. Third, this thesis couples the channel estimator to the geocast algorithm, producing a closed-loop load-reactive system that allows geocasts to adapt to instantaneous channel conditions. Simulations showed that this system is not only shown to be more efficient in channel use and be able to adapt to channel contention, but is also able to self-correct suboptimal retransmission decisions. Finally, this thesis demonstrates that all tested network simulators exhibit unexpected behaviours when simulating broadcasts. This thesis describes in depth the error in ns-3, leading to a set of workarounds that allows results from most versions of ns-3 to be interpreted correctly

    Performance Prediction and Tuning for Symmetric Coexistence of WiFi and ZigBee Networks

    Get PDF
    Due to the explosive deployment of WiFi and ZigBee wireless networks, 2.4GHz ISM bands (2.4GHz-2.5GHz) are becoming increasingly crowded, and the co-channel coexistence of these two networks is inevitable. For coexistence networks, people always want to predict their performance (e.g. throughput, energy consumption, etc.) before deployment, or even want to tune parameters to compensate unnecessary performance degradation (owing to the huge differences between these two MAC protocols) or to satisfy some performance requirements (e.g., priority, delay constraint, etc.) of them. However, predicting and tuning performance of coexisting WiFi and ZigBee networks has been a challenging task, primarily due to the lack of corresponding simulators and analytical models. In this dissertation, we addressed the aforementioned problems by presenting simulators and models for the coexistence of WiFi and ZigBee devices. Specifically, based on the energy efficiency and traffic pattern of three practical coexistence scenarios: disaster rescue site, smart hospital and home automation. We first of all classify them into three classes, which are non-sleeping devices with saturated traffic (SAT), non-sleeping devices with unsaturated traffic (UNSAT) and duty-cycling devices with unsaturated traffic (DC-UNSAT). Then a simulator and an analytical model are proposed for each class, where each simulator is verified by simple hardware based experiment. Next, we derive the expressions for performance metrics like throughput, delay etc., and predict them using both the proposed simulator and the model. Due to the higher accuracy of the simulator, the results from them are used as the ground truth to validate the accuracy of the model. Last, according to some common performance tuning requirements for each class, we formulate them into optimization problems and propose the corresponding solving methods. The results show that the proposed simulators have high accuracy in performance prediction, while the models, although are less accurate than the former, can be used in fast prediction. In particular, the models can also be easily used in optimization problems for performance tuning, and the results prove its high efficiency

    On Boosting Integrated WLAN & ZigBee Network Performance via Load Balancing

    Get PDF
    Network traffic and overload are constantly increasing. This situation leads to congestion and packet losses at bottlenecks and across the different parts and devices of the network. Luckily, network technologies and techniques are developing rapidly. This paper is dedicated to applying and testing the impact of load balancing mechanisms on network performance. Two networking scenarios are considered: server on-premise and server on cloud . The research takes place in a vast scale network where two of the most popular technologies are spotted in an integrated multiprotocol scenario of Wireless Area networks (WLAN) with the Internet of Things (IoT) ZigBee. Previous studies were concerned by the challenges present due to the very different natures of IoT ZigBee and WLAN networks. This paper presents a better quality of service (QoS) by applying load balancing to these integrated scenarios. Not just that, it also introduces an even better Qos by deploying the rapidly growing popular technology of cloud computing to the same scenario of integrated networks with load balancing. By applying the same data rates with the same timers and networking parameters, network performance is measured and compared to show the difference between previous work without load balancing, and this papers work after deploying load balancing. The research shows whether load balancing has a positive or a negative effect on network performance or does not affect some cases. The network performance parameters under consideration are traffic dropped; traffic received, delay and throughput. Load balancing is tested regarding two different server positions

    Throughput Maximization in Unmanned Aerial Vehicle Networks

    Get PDF
    The use of Unmanned Aerial Vehicles (UAVs) swarms in civilian applications such as surveillance, agriculture, search and rescue, and border patrol is becoming popular. UAVs have also found use as mobile or portable base stations. In these applications, communication requirements for UAVs are generally stricter as compared to conventional aircrafts. Hence, there needs to be an efficient Medium Access Control (MAC) protocol that ensures UAVs experience low channel access delays and high throughput. Some challenges when designing UAVs MAC protocols include interference and rapidly changing channel states, which require a UAV to adapt its data rate to ensure data transmission success. Other challenges include Quality of Service (QoS) requirements and multiple contending UAVs that result in collisions and channel access delays. To this end, this thesis aims to utilize Multi-Packet Reception (MPR) technology. In particular, it considers nodes that are equipped with a Successive Interference Cancellation (SIC) radio, and thereby, allowing them to receive multiple transmissions simultaneously. A key problem is to identify a suitable a Time Division Multiple Access (TDMA) transmission schedule that allows UAVs to transmit successfully and frequently. Moreover, in order for SIC to operate, there must be a sufficient difference in received power. However, in practice, due to the location and orientation of nodes, the received power of simultaneously transmitting nodes may cause SIC decoding to fail at a receiver. Consequently, a key problem concerns the placement and orientation of UAVs to ensure there is diversity in received signal strength at a receiving node. Lastly, interference between UAVs serving as base station is a critical issue. In particular, their respective location may have excessive interference or cause interference to other UAVs; all of which have an impact on the schedule used by these UAVs to serve their respective users

    VoIP Call Admission Control in WLANs in Presence of Elastic Traffic

    Get PDF
    VoIP service over WLAN networks is a promising alternative to provide mobile voice communications. However, several performance problems appear due to i) heavy protocol overheads, ii) unfairness and asymmetry between the uplink and downlink flows, and iii) the coexistence with other traffic flows. This paper addresses the performance of VoIP communications with simultaneous presence of bidirectional TCP traffic, and shows how the presence of elastic flows drastically reduces the capacity of the system. To solve this limitation a simple solution is proposed using an adaptive Admission and Rate Control algorithm which tunes the BEB (Binary Exponential Backoff) parameters. Analytical results are obtained by using an IEEE 802.11e user centric queuing model based on a bulk service M=G[1;B]=1=K queue, which is able to capture the main dynamics of the EDCA-based traffic differentiation parameters (AIFS, BEB and TXOP). The results show that the improvement achieved by our scheme on the overall VoIP performance is significant

    Estimating Average End-to-End Delays in IEEE 802.11 Multihop Wireless Networks

    Get PDF
    In this paper, we present a new analytic model for evaluating average end-to-end delay in IEEE 802.11 multihop wireless networks. Our model gives closed expressions for the end-to-end delay in function of arrivals and service time patterns. Each node is modeled as a M/M/1/K queue from which we can derive expressions for service time via queueing theory. By combining this delay evaluation with different admission controls, we design a protocol called DEAN (Delay Estimation in Ad hoc Networks). DEAN is able to provide delay guarantees for QoS applications in function of the application level requirements. Through extensive simulations, we compare performance evaluation of DEAN with other approaches like, for instance, DDA

    Towards next generation WLANs: exploiting coordination and cooperation

    Get PDF
    Wireless Local Area Networks (WLANs) operating in the industrial, scientific and medical (ISM) radio bands have gained great popularity and increasing usage over the past few years. The corresponding MAC/PHY specification, the IEEE 802.11 standard, has also evolved to adapt to such development. However, as the number of WLAN mobile users increases, and as their needs evolve in the face of new applications, there is an ongoing need for the further evolution of the IEEE 802.11 standard. In this thesis we propose several MAC/PHY layer protocols and schemes that will provide more system throughput, lower packet delivery delay and lessen the power consumption of mobile devices. Our work investigates three approaches that lead to improved WLAN performance: 1) cross-layer design of the PHY and MAC layers for larger system throughput, 2) exploring the use of implicit coordination among clients to increase the efficiency of random media access, and 3) improved packets dispatching by the access points (APs) to preserve the battery of mobile devices. Each proposed solution is supported by theoretical proofs and extensively studied by simulations or experiments on testbeds
    • …
    corecore